✨ Want to boost your child’s speech and language skills in a simple, everyday way? Try adding visual cues. Kids learn best when they can see what words mean.
Think:
👋 A wave when you say “bye-bye”
📦 Pointing to objects as you name them
😊 Exaggerated facial expressions for new sounds
🖼️ Pictures or gestures to support new vocabulary
Visual cues give kids an extra anchor to understand, remember, and use language. Tiny tweaks, big impact.
